a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orLibravatar Vijay A <vraravam@users.noreply.github.com>2022-04-19 15:14:57 -0500
committerLibravatar Vijay A <vraravam@users.noreply.github.com>2022-04-19 15:14:57 -0500
commit9aeaf571ed213cd2db63fed4313b473b969870ed (patch)
treea5dc6d84b561f4ca0e3b6bd3b4ad779142a8e6cd
parentFix app name for linux 'About' dialog (diff)
downloadferdium-app-master.tar.gz
ferdium-app-master.tar.zst
ferdium-app-master.zip
Turn off signing of mac and windows artifacts till we get the licensesmaster
-rw-r--r--.github/workflows/builds.yml32
1 files changed, 20 insertions, 12 deletions
diff --git a/.github/workflows/builds.yml b/.github/workflows/builds.yml
index 3729cf4a8..5c2535587 100644
--- a/.github/workflows/builds.yml
+++ b/.github/workflows/builds.yml
@@ -161,20 +161,24 @@ jobs:
161 shell: bash 161 shell: bash
162 env: 162 env:
163 GH_TOKEN: ${{ secrets.FERDIUM_PUBLISH_TOKEN }} 163 GH_TOKEN: ${{ secrets.FERDIUM_PUBLISH_TOKEN }}
164 APPLEID: ${{ secrets.APPLEID }} 164 CSC_IDENTITY_AUTO_DISCOVERY: false
165 APPLEID_PASSWORD: ${{ secrets.APPLEID_PASSWORD }} 165 # TODO: Commented out the code signing process for now (so as to at least get unsigned nightlies available for testing)
166 CSC_LINK: ${{ secrets.CSC_LINK }} 166 # APPLEID: ${{ secrets.APPLEID }}
167 CSC_KEY_PASSWORD: ${{ secrets.CSC_KEY_PASSWORD }} 167 # APPLEID_PASSWORD: ${{ secrets.APPLEID_PASSWORD }}
168 # CSC_LINK: ${{ secrets.CSC_LINK }}
169 # CSC_KEY_PASSWORD: ${{ secrets.CSC_KEY_PASSWORD }}
168 - name: Build Ferdium with publish for 'release' branch 170 - name: Build Ferdium with publish for 'release' branch
169 if: ${{ env.GIT_BRANCH_NAME == 'release' }} 171 if: ${{ env.GIT_BRANCH_NAME == 'release' }}
170 run: npm run build -- --publish always -c.publish.provider=github -c.publish.owner=${{ github.repository_owner }} -c.publish.repo=ferdium 172 run: npm run build -- --publish always -c.publish.provider=github -c.publish.owner=${{ github.repository_owner }} -c.publish.repo=ferdium
171 shell: bash 173 shell: bash
172 env: 174 env:
173 GH_TOKEN: ${{ secrets.FERDIUM_PUBLISH_TOKEN }} 175 GH_TOKEN: ${{ secrets.FERDIUM_PUBLISH_TOKEN }}
174 APPLEID: ${{ secrets.APPLEID }} 176 CSC_IDENTITY_AUTO_DISCOVERY: false
175 APPLEID_PASSWORD: ${{ secrets.APPLEID_PASSWORD }} 177 # TODO: Commented out the code signing process for now (so as to at least get unsigned nightlies available for testing)
176 CSC_LINK: ${{ secrets.CSC_LINK }} 178 # APPLEID: ${{ secrets.APPLEID }}
177 CSC_KEY_PASSWORD: ${{ secrets.CSC_KEY_PASSWORD }} 179 # APPLEID_PASSWORD: ${{ secrets.APPLEID_PASSWORD }}
180 # CSC_LINK: ${{ secrets.CSC_LINK }}
181 # CSC_KEY_PASSWORD: ${{ secrets.CSC_KEY_PASSWORD }}
178 182
179 build_linux: 183 build_linux:
180 name: 'ubuntu ${{ github.event.inputs.message }}' 184 name: 'ubuntu ${{ github.event.inputs.message }}'
@@ -339,13 +343,17 @@ jobs:
339 shell: bash 343 shell: bash
340 env: 344 env:
341 GH_TOKEN: ${{ secrets.FERDIUM_PUBLISH_TOKEN }} 345 GH_TOKEN: ${{ secrets.FERDIUM_PUBLISH_TOKEN }}
342 WIN_CSC_LINK: ${{ secrets.WIN_CSC_LINK }} 346 CSC_IDENTITY_AUTO_DISCOVERY: false
343 WIN_CSC_KEY_PASSWORD: ${{ secrets.WIN_CSC_KEY_PASSWORD }} 347 # TODO: Commented out the code signing process for now (so as to at least get unsigned nightlies available for testing)
348 # WIN_CSC_LINK: ${{ secrets.WIN_CSC_LINK }}
349 # WIN_CSC_KEY_PASSWORD: ${{ secrets.WIN_CSC_KEY_PASSWORD }}
344 - name: Build Ferdium with publish for 'release' branch 350 - name: Build Ferdium with publish for 'release' branch
345 if: ${{ env.GIT_BRANCH_NAME == 'release' }} 351 if: ${{ env.GIT_BRANCH_NAME == 'release' }}
346 run: npm run build -- --publish always -c.publish.provider=github -c.publish.owner=${{ github.repository_owner }} -c.publish.repo=ferdium 352 run: npm run build -- --publish always -c.publish.provider=github -c.publish.owner=${{ github.repository_owner }} -c.publish.repo=ferdium
347 shell: bash 353 shell: bash
348 env: 354 env:
349 GH_TOKEN: ${{ secrets.FERDIUM_PUBLISH_TOKEN }} 355 GH_TOKEN: ${{ secrets.FERDIUM_PUBLISH_TOKEN }}
350 WIN_CSC_LINK: ${{ secrets.WIN_CSC_LINK }} 356 CSC_IDENTITY_AUTO_DISCOVERY: false
351 WIN_CSC_KEY_PASSWORD: ${{ secrets.WIN_CSC_KEY_PASSWORD }} 357 # TODO: Commented out the code signing process for now (so as to at least get unsigned nightlies available for testing)
358 # WIN_CSC_LINK: ${{ secrets.WIN_CSC_LINK }}
359 # WIN_CSC_KEY_PASSWORD: ${{ secrets.WIN_CSC_KEY_PASSWORD }}